Services Offered in Pediatric Restorative Dentistry

Our pediatric restorative dentistry services are designed to restore both function and appearance. We offer a range of treatments to address your child’s dental needs.

Fillings and Crowns

  • Fillings are used to treat cavities, preventing further decay and restoring the tooth's structure.

  • Crowns restore teeth that are severely damaged, providing strength and protection to ensure long-term dental health.

Bonding and Veneers

  • Bonding is a quick and cost-effective solution for repairing chipped, cracked, or decayed teeth.

  • Veneers are thin layers of porcelain placed over the front of the teeth to improve appearance and strength.

Space Maintainers

If your child loses a baby tooth prematurely, space maintainers keep the remaining teeth from shifting, helping to guide the permanent teeth into the correct position.
